Types of Honda Keys
Honda lorries normally use 3 main kinds of keys. Each includes its matching replacement expenses.
Key TypeDescriptionAverage Cost (Replacement)Traditional KeyA basic metal key, no electronic parts.₤ 10 - ₤ 30Transponder KeyA key with a chip that communicates with the automobile.₤ 50 - ₤ 150Smart Key/Key FobA keyless entry system that includes sophisticated functions.₤ 200 - ₤ 500Conventional Keys
Standard metal keys are one of the most fundamental type. They do not consist of any electronic part and are relatively economical to replace. Nevertheless, newer Honda designs are less most likely to make use of these keys.
Transponder Keys
Transponder keys are geared up with a chip that sends out a signal to the car's immobilizer system. This prevents unapproved access. The replacement cost for transponder keys consists of setting the key, which can intensify costs.
Smart Keys/Key Fobs
Smart keys, also called key fobs, are the most technologically innovative and are progressively common in modern Honda automobiles. These keys frequently permit users to open doors and start the engine without inserting the key into the ignition. Due to their functions and the sophisticated technology involved, they tend to be the most costly to replace.
Elements Affecting Key Replacement Costs
Numerous aspects can affect the total cost of changing your Honda key. Some of these include:
Type of Key: As outlined, the kind of key straight affects rate.Model and Year: Newer models and top-of-the-line cars frequently include sophisticated technology, making key replacement more expensive.Dealership vs. Locksmith: Consulting a dealership is typically more costly compared to regional locksmiths, but dealerships may offer a more comprehensive service warranty and service.Setting Fees: Newer keys need to be configured to the car, which incurs additional costs.Location: Prices may vary depending on the area and regional market rates.Prices Breakdown

Q1: How long does it take to replace a Honda key?A1: Replacement duration can vary, but normally, it takes anywhere from a couple of minutes to an hour, depending on the key type and whether programming is required. Q2: Can I replace my Honda key myself?A2: While some traditionalkeys can be replicated at the majority of hardware shops, transponder and smart keys require particular shows that normally requires a dealership or certified locksmith professional. Q3: Is it possible to get a replacement key without the original?A3: Yes, it's possible, but the process might differ by car dealership or locksmith.
They might need your automobile recognition number( VIN)and evidence of ownership. Q4: What need to I do if my key fob stops working?A4: First, check if the battery needs replacement. If that does not deal with the concern, speak with a dealer or locksmith professional for more assessment.
